As digital markets continue to mature and diversify, scaling solutions have become crucial to address the scalability and transaction cost challenges faced by cryptocurrency networks.

Layer 2 projects offer innovative solutions to improve the efficiency of existing blockchains by moving some of the workload out of the core layer of the blockchain. These solutions include sidechains, rollups, and other scaling techniques that allow a greater number of transactions to be carried out without compromising the security or decentralization of the network.

One reason Layer 2 projects are increasingly seen as key players in the next bull run is their ability to address congestion and high transaction fees that have hampered mass adoption of cryptocurrencies . By offloading some traffic to secondary layers, these solutions can reduce confirmation times and costs associated with transactions, making cryptocurrencies more accessible and usable for more people.

Additionally, Layer 2 projects often offer enhanced features, such as more efficient smart contracts, improved privacy features, and increased interoperability between different blockchains. These additional features increase the appeal of Layer 2 projects for developers and users, paving the way for new applications and innovative use cases.

Although Layer 2 projects have enormous potential, it is important to note that they are not without their own challenges and limitations. Issues such as security, governance and adoption remain top concerns for many investors and industry players. Furthermore, competition between different Layer 2 projects is fierce, and only those who manage to offer technically sound and economically viable solutions can hope to stand out in the rapidly evolving landscape of cryptocurrencies.
